    Default good free site to search completed sales?

    hi folks, im wondering if any of you know of a good site i can search for free for completed sales in an area. there is a foreclosure sale tomorrow, and i am trying to find what's actually SOLD in the area, not listed. i tried searching on google, and realtor.com, but no properties came up(unlikely, in an entire zip code of philly).any help would be greatly appreciated. thanks!

    The only site that allows for the public to search closed sales is propertyshark.com. And that site does not have all of them nor does it cover all areas.     You can try Zillow, but I would not put too much stock in their data. They have been known to be grossly inaccurate. You can also try you county clerk of property appraiser's website.
